body {
font-family: Verdana, Georgia, "Bookman Old Style", Bookman, "New Century Schoolbook", "Bookman Antiqua", Palatino, "Utopia", "New York", "Times New Roman", Times, serif;
font-size: 12pt;
color: #000;
background-color: #fff;
}

#cadre-haut ul.bloc-menu-haut, #cadre-colonne-1, #cadre-colonne-2, #fil-ariane, #mentions-legales, #menu_baseline {
display: none;
}

#cadre-haut {
display: block;
text-align: center;
min-height:130px;
}
#logo{
	width:124px;
	height:124px;
	position:absolute;
	top:5px;
	left:5px;
}
h1 {
font-size: 16pt;
font-weight: bold;
text-align: center;
}

h2 {
font-size: 14pt;
}

h3,h4,h5,h6 {
font-size: 12pt;
}
img{
	margin:0 12pt;
}
dl.actu-lst dt {
	float:left;
}

#zone-coordonnees{
	padding-top: 24pt;
}
#zone-coordonnees, #cadre-principal-bas {
text-align: center;
clear:both;
}
#article, #nouveau, #ancien {
border-bottom: 1px solid;
padding-bottom: 24pt;
line-height: 16pt;
}

#article p, #nouveau p, #ancien p, #externes p {
text-indent: 24pt;
}



.signature, #nouveau h2, #externes, .listeArticles, .liensExternes, h1#ressources, h1#apropos, h1#ailleurs, h1#contact {
border-bottom: 1px solid;
padding-bottom: 24pt;
}

#nouveau h2, #ancien h2, #externes h2 {
text-align: center;
font-size: 12pt;
}

#bio h2, #fiche h2 {
font-size: 14pt;
}

#home .auteur {
display: block;
font-size: 12pt;
page-break-before: avoid !important;
}

.listeArticles dt, .liensExternes dt {
font-weight: bold;
margin-top: 12pt;
}

.listeArticles dd, .liensExternes dd {
margin-left: 0;
}

pre {
border: 1px dotted;
padding: 12pt;
}

blockquote,q {
font-style: italic;
quotes: "\00AB\00A0" "\00A0\00BB" "\0022" "\0022";
}

abbr, acronym {
border: 0;
}
abbr[title]:after,acronym[title]:after{
content: " (" attr(title) ")";
font-style: italic;
}

a {
text-decoration : none !important;
font-style: italic;
color: #000;
background-color: #fff;
}

/*#cadre-colonne-milieu a:after, #cadre-colonne-milieu a[hreflang]:after {
content: " [\00A0" attr(href) "\00A0]";
}
#cadre-colonne-milieu a:after img, #cadre-colonne-milieu a[hreflang]:after img {
content: "";
}*/
pre, code, table { 
page-break-inside : avoid !important; 
}

h1,h2,h3,h4,h5,h6 {
page-break-after : avoid !important; 
}

#credits {
page-break-before : avoid !important;
}


#drapeaux, #diaporama_masque{
	display			:	none;
}